LOCATION
We are 1 hour and 20 minutes on the direct train from central London (Victoria Station) making it an easy day or overnight visit. Our local train station, Pulborough, is a 12 minute drive from the house. Pulborough Station is a 45 minute train ride to London Gatwick Airport which is 40 minute drive from the house.
Storrington is a small town at the foot of the South Downs. It has coffee shops, cafés, pubs, restaurants, a bank, a post office, pharmacies, news agents, petrol stations, and Waitrose and Tesco Express supermarkets among several boutique shops.
For those that love to walk, you can do so directly from the house through woodland, parkland and farmland on various public footpaths. There are also breathtaking walks to be found in the majestic South Downs National Park, and in particular, the historic South Downs Way.
There are a number of local vineyards and wineries in the immediate vicinity including Nyetimber, Wiston, Kinsbrook, and Nutbourne among others. There is something quite wonderful about enjoying some of England’s best sparkling wine on the terrace, knowing that it was grown and produced just around the corner!
There is plenty to do in this part of West Sussex. See the “amenities” section for a comprehensive list of activities within easy reach. Some activities have not been listed due to being a little further than 15 minutes away, but are still available close by. Here is a brief list - golf, water sports, road biking, mountain biking, south downs light railway, south downs gliding club, historic houses, Arundel Castle and historic town, Chichester Cathedral and City, wetland & bird watching centres, Worthing and Brighton piers and the i360, trampoline parks, soft play, indoor climbing, driving ranges, crazy golf and more.
There are lots of good restaurants and gastro pubs in the area including the Pig in the South Downs, Chalk at the Wiston Winery, the Parson’s Table in Arundel, the Black Horse in Amberley, the Black Rabbit in Arundel and many more.
